CuClad 217 2-Layer 20mil PCB with Immersion Gold Finish
The CuClad 217 2-Layer PCB is a high-performance circuit board engineered for RF and microwave applications requiring superior electrical and mechanical stability. Built with Rogers CuClad 217 laminates, this PCB features a 20mil PTFE fiberglass composite core offering an exceptionally low dielectric constant and dissipation factor, enabling faster signal propagation and minimal signal loss. The Immersion Gold finish ensures excellent solderability and enhanced corrosion resistance, making it ideal for high-frequency, precision-critical designs.
![]()
Designed for applications such as radars, microwave components, and electronic countermeasures, this PCB delivers exceptional performance with IPC-Class-2 compliance and 100% electrical testing prior to shipment. Its optimized stackup and superior material properties make it a reliable choice for advanced RF applications.
Key Construction Details
| Parameter | Specification |
| Base Material | Rogers CuClad 217 |
| Layer Count | 2 layers |
| Board Dimensions | 89mm x 56mm, tolerance: +/- 0.15mm |
| Finished Board Thickness | 0.6mm |
| Copper Weight | 1oz (1.4 mils) outer layers |
| Minimum Trace/Space | 4/5 mils |
| Minimum Hole Size | 0.2mm |
| Blind Vias | No |
| Via Plating Thickness | 20 μm |
| Surface Finish | Immersion Gold |
| Top Silkscreen | White |
| Bottom Silkscreen | None |
| Solder Mask | Blue (Top only) |
| Electrical Testing | 100% tested prior to shipment |
This PCB stands out with blue solder mask on the top layer for added protection and durability, and white silkscreen for clear labeling and component identification.

What is Rogers CuClad 217 Laminate?
The CuClad 217 laminate is a high-performance PTFE-based material reinforced with cross-plied woven fiberglass. With its low dielectric constant (Dk) and extremely low dissipation factor, it provides exceptional signal propagation and low circuit losses, even at high frequencies. Its PTFE-to-glass ratio ensures uniform dielectric properties, while its cross-plied construction enhances mechanical and electrical isotropy in the X-Y plane.
Key Features of CuClad 217 Material:
| Property | Value |
| Dielectric Constant (Dk) | 2.17 or 2.20 (10GHz / 1MHz) |
| Dissipation Factor | 0.0009 at 10GHz |
| Moisture Absorption | 0.02% |
| Peel Strength | 14 lbs/in |
| Outgassing | TML: 0.01%, CVCM: 0.01%, WVR: 0% |
| Reinforcement | Cross-plied woven fiberglass |
Benefits of the CuClad 217 PCB
Low Signal Loss: The low dissipation factor (0.0009 at 10GHz) ensures minimal signal attenuation, critical for high-frequency designs.
Stable Dielectric Properties: The low dielectric constant (Dk) of 2.17 or 2.20 provides superior signal propagation and supports wider line widths for reduced insertion loss.
Enhanced Dimensional Stability: The cross-plied fiberglass structure ensures excellent mechanical stability and isotropy in the X-Y plane.
Moisture and Chemical Resistance: With a moisture absorption rate as low as 0.02%, the PCB maintains stable performance in humid or harsh environments.
High Reliability: The low Z-axis coefficient of thermal expansion (CTE) improves reliability of plated-through holes (PTHs), even under thermal stress.
